On Sun, Feb 22, 2026 at 08:33:52AM +0000, Fuad Tabba wrote:
> Commit 0c4762e26879 ("KVM: arm64: nv: Avoid NV stage-2 code when NV is
> not supported") added an early return to several functions in
> arch/arm64/kvm/nested.c to prevent a UBSAN shift-out-of-bounds error
> when accessing the pgt union for non-nested VMs.

Thanks Fuad, that seems to have been it:

Tested-by: Mark Brown <broonie at kernel.org>

The patch also seems to address some spurious OOMs that I was able to
reproduce with qemu when running the kselftests on pKVM:
